Let’s talk about the Extra Special Bitter (ESB). It’s a style that doesn’t always get the hype of a triple-dry-hopped IPA or a pastry stout, but when it’s done right, it’s pure liquid comfort. While Holy Mountain Brewing is usually the land of “oak-aged everything,” I decided to take a detour into their more traditional side with the Bitter Peace ESB when we first arrived at the taproom last Sunday....

Ascending the Peak for Holy Mountain Brewing’s 11th
Holy Mountain Brewing is talked about in Seattle with the kind of reverence usually reserved for rare vinyl finds or secret fishing spots. For years, we’ve nodding along while friends raved about their foudre-aged saisons and “doom metal vibes,” but other than our year of visiting every Washington brewery in 2022, we hadn’t been back....
